Hace 6 días · In probability theory and statistics, the Poisson distribution is a discrete probability distribution that expresses the probability of a given number of events occurring in a fixed interval of time if these events occur with a known constant mean rate and independently of the time since the last event.     Hace 2 días · A Markov chain or Markov process is a stochastic model describing a sequence of possible events in which the probability of each event depends only on the state attained in the previous event.   5. Hace 5 días · The Geometric distribution is a special case of the Negative Binomial distribution in which α = 1 and θ = β / ( 1 + β). The continuous analog of the Geometric distribution is the Exponential distribution.
